Oronoco, MN (KROC-AM News)- A southeast Minnesota man is in custody for an armed robbery at a Rochester-area gas station.

Olmsted County Sheriff’s Office Tim Parkin said Friday that deputies responded to the reported robbery around 4:30 Tuesday afternoon.

He said the alleged robbery occurred a few hours before it was reported.

The robbery was reported at the Gas and Go, located at 1455 Cedar Center Ave SE in Oronoco. 

Deputies learned a man had entered the store, brandished a firearm and took the clerk’s phone and left the store, according to the sheriff’s office. 

Suspect Identified

Parkin said investigators identified the armed robbery suspect as 43-year-old Norman Sommerfield of Chatfield

The sheriff’s office says Somerfeld was subsequently involved in a hit and run in Chatfield and was later taken into custody.

Olmsted County Adult Detention Center records indicate Sommerfield was booked into jail on suspicion of first-degree aggravated robbery and theft by pick pocketing shortly before 11:00 Wednesday morning.

He is due to make his first court appearance Friday morning.
